Increasing public health status can be manifested through conventional and traditional medicines.Traditional medicines carry a health paradigm that focuses on the healthy, complementary side ofconventional medicine and preventive promotive efforts. Puskesmas is a health service facility thatprioritizes promotive and preventive to improve community health status. Puskesmas can be saidimplementing traditional health if they meet one of the criteria: have traditional medicine-trained staff,carry out coaching, and perform self-care traditional medicine. West Java Province has a smaller numberof health centers providing traditional health compared to other provinces in Java. Kabupaten Bogor(District of Bogor) as the most densely populated in the West Java Province has its midwives and nursesAnalisis implementasi..., Evita Diniawati, FKM UI, 2018ixUniversitas Indonesiacertified in acupressure in these Puskesmas: Ciawi, Caringin, and Ciomas. This study aims to discoverinformation of how traditional health program being implemented in Puskesmas Ciawi, PuskesmasCaringin, and Puskesmas Ciomas. This qualitative study uses following methods: document review,observation, and in-depth interview. The study reveals there were no acupressure services in those threepuskesmas because the health workers were kept occupied by other workload, traditional health guidancecould be improved through an inventory of traditional health data, identification of traditional healthservices in their working areas, and guidance to traditional health professionals. The three puskesmas didnot implement self-care traditional medicine because they do not have trained independent care staff butcan be implemented by community empowerment with TOGA and acupressure socialization for minorcomplaints.

Tesis ini membahas tentang hak reproduksi perempuan dalam perkawinan transnasional di Kota Singkawang Kalimantan Barat Tahun 2013. Tujuan penelitian ini untuk mengetahui pola perkawinan, faktor-faktor yang mendukung dan hak reproduksi perempuan dalam perkawinan transnasional. Metode penelitian ini kualitatif dengan metode wawancara mendalam terhadap 6 informan, 6 informan keluarga dan 6 informan kunci.
Hasil penelitian menunjukkan bahwa faktor pendukung dalam perkawinan transnasional adalah sosial ekonomi yang rendah; persamaan agama, bahasa dan etnis serta persepsi positif tentang negara Taiwan. Hak reproduksi perempuan dengan status pisah yang tidak terpenuhi yaitu hak untuk membangun dan merencanakan keluarga, hak untuk bebas dari segala bentuk diskriminasi dalam keluarga dan kesehatan reproduksi, hak untuk bebas dari penganiayaan dan perlakuan buruk dan hak untuk menentukan jumlah anak dan jarak kelahiran. Pemerintah daerah Kota Singkawang perlu meningkatkan kerjasama lintas sektoral antara instansi dan lembaga masyarakat, pencatatan yang baik jumlah warga yang menikah dengan Warga Negara Asing dan penyuluhan yang berkaitan dengan perkawinan transnasional dan kesehatan reproduksi dengan menggunakan bahasa setempat.
The focus of this study is the reproductive rights of women in transnational marriages in Singkawang West Kalimantan in 2013, aim to determine the patterns of marriage, the factors that support and reproductive rights of women in transnational marriages. This qualitative study using in-depth interviews of 6 informants, 6 family informants and 6 key informants.
The results showed that factors related in transnational marriage are low socioeconomic; similiarities in religion, language and ethnicity; positive perceptions about Taiwan. Unfullfill reproductive rights of divorced women are the right to build and plan a family, the right to be free from all forms of discrimination in the family and reproductive health, the right to be free from torture and ill-treatment and the right to determine the number and spacing of children. Singkawang local governments need to improve cross-sectoral cooperation between institutions and community organizations, having acurate recording of citizens who are married to foreign citizens and having counseling program related to transnational marriage and reproductive health by using the local language.
